Kings Path Partners's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Kings Path Partners held 342 positions worth $271M, up 9.3% from $248M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 58% of the portfolio.

Kings Path Partners deployed $9.84M of net new capital in Q3 2025, opening 59 new positions and adding to 56 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was BNY Mellon Core Bond ETF: 9,873 shares worth $421K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 2.1% of assets, down from 2.7%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Aris Water Solutions, an estimated $502K trimmed.
